I've implemented Tiny Slider in my Next.js app which requires an inline script on the page to control the slider's behavior. Now while the script loads properly the first time I launch index.js, however whenever I navigate to another page using Link and come back to index.js, the script doesn't load.
Here's how I've written the script in index.js

I need the script to load every time index.js loads, not just the first time around. Any ideas on how I can do this? The entire code is here - https://github.com/YaddyVirus/Esttheva
Here are the steps to adding tina-slider to a next.js app.
// pages/_document.js
import { Html, Head, Main, NextScript } from 'next/document'
export default function Document() {
return (
<Html>
<Head>
<link rel="stylesheet" href="https://cdnjs.cloudflare.com/ajax/libs/tiny-slider/2.9.2/tiny-slider.css" />
</Head>
<body>
<Main />
<NextScript />
</body>
</Html>
)
}
import { useEffect, useRef } from "react";
const App = () => {
const ref = useRef(true);
useEffect(() => {
let slider;
// Tiny slider only can be loaded once and can only be loaded clint side
if (typeof window !== "undefined" && ref.current) {
ref.current = false;
// Lazy load the slider code client side
import("tiny-slider").then((x) => {
slider = x.tns({
container: ".slider",
items: 3,
slideBy: "page",
autoplay: true
});
});
}
// Destory the slider when it is unmouted
return slider?.destroy();
}, []);
return (
<div>
<div className="slider">
<div>1</div>
<div>2</div>
<div>3</div>
<div>4</div>
<div>5</div>
<div>6</div>
</div>
</div>
);
};
export default App;

Here is a couple of key notes about the solution
ref keeps track of if the hook as already been called (as of react 18 hooks get called twice in dev mode)typeof window !== "undefined" to ensure that tiny-window only gets loaded client side and not on the server (this causes a "window is undefined" Error)tns function as per the docs
